aug 5, 1966 - Beatles Revolver Album Released

Description:

The Beatles Album, Revolver was a watershed moment in the music industry. Music in the '60s had become almost homogenous and stagnant with most top songs being about young love, with upbeat pop tunes. Revolver was a collection of all original songs which all conveyed a common message about the human experience and life. The songs talked about the reality of death and wanting to make the most out of life. The music itself was very unique with various innovative post-production effects applied to the sound. The music world had never heard anything like it, it drew the attention of the 60’s counterculture movement. The Beatles were also known to use the drug LSD, with their popularity use of the drug became widespread in counter-cultural hotspots like California.
